Miss Valley St 30, Alcorn St 26
 
  RECAP | BOX SCORE

LORMAN, Miss. (AP) _ Corey Holmes ran for 237 yards and three touchdowns to lead Mississippi Valley State to a 30-26 victory over in-state rival Alcorn State on Saturday.

Mississippi Valley (3-7, 1-3 Southwestern Athletic Conference), who has won three straight games after opening the season with seven consecutive loses, built a 24-7 lead at the half.

Marcus Taylor threw three touchdown passes in the second half to cut into the Delta Devils' advantage. Alcorn State (3-5, 1-1), who has lost three straight games, cut the lead to 30-26 with 1:42 remaining on Taylor's 10-yard pass to Marco Walder

But the Braves could not get the ball back after the score. The loss dashed any hope of Alcorn winning the SWAC's Eastern Division.

Alcorn had a 7-0 lead in the opening minute of the game on Taylor's 13-yard touchdown pass to Walder.

But Holmes rushed for 156 yards in the first half and scored on a 2-yard touchdown run with 11:20 remaining in the first quarter bringing the Delta Devils to within 7-6.

Holmes' 22-yard touchdown run on the second play of the second quarter put Valley ahead 12-7 with 14:48 to play in the half.

Melvin Williams then took over with two touchdown passes in the quarter, a 57-yard throw to Terrell Adams and 42-yard pass to John Wilson to give the Delta Devils the 24-7 lead at the half.

Alcorn State had 463 total yards but only four yards rushing.

The Braves play their season finale at Jackson State, which is 3-0 in the SWAC Eastern Division games with no more to play until Alcorn State.
